EU Commission Won't Seek Termination of Payment If Reasons Are Justified

Bratislava, February 11 (TASR) - Head of the European Commission's Directorate General for Regional Policy (DG Regio) Dirk Ahner said Thursday he would expect Slovakia to justify the delays in the implementation of European directives and in allowing the public to participate in the proceedings greenlighting select projects otherwise the country will forfeit EU funds.

The problem arose when motorway construction was put above the rights of the public to co-decide on their living environments when measures were approved to speed up motorway construction back in 2007, as Ahner recently wrote to Slovakia's ambassador to the EU Ivan Korcok.

The Environment Ministry said that the drawing of eurofunds is not in danger. "The ministry is doing its utmost to align national legislation with European Union directives within a set deadline," namely May this year.

At its special session Thursday, the Slovak Government approved an amendment to the law on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A), which should give the general public a bigger say in decision-making.
